Recognizing EVO ICL and Its Advantages for Dry Eyes



When it comes to taking care of completely dry eyes, recognizing the EVO ICL (Implantable Collamer Lens) can be a game-changer. This innovative lens uses a special solution for those that battle with completely dry eye signs and symptoms, specifically after standard vision modification procedures.

Unlike LASIK, the EVO ICL does not include improving the cornea, which commonly intensifies dryness. Instead, it's implanted behind the iris, protecting the natural framework of your eye. This implies you're much less most likely to experience completely dry eye difficulties post-surgery.

Contrasting EVO ICL and LASIK: Secret Differences



While both EVO ICL and LASIK are popular vision adjustment choices, they differ substantially in their technique and results.

EVO ICL includes implanting a lens inside your eye, providing a reversible option without altering the cornea. This suggests if your vision modifications, changes can be made easily.

On the other hand, LASIK improves the cornea using a laser, completely changing its framework.  Get More Information  can cause issues like dry eyes, especially for those currently vulnerable to the condition.

Healing times also differ; EVO ICL generally provides a quicker visual recovery, while LASIK may require more downtime.

That Is a Perfect Prospect for EVO ICL?



A perfect candidate for EVO ICL commonly drops within specific age and vision parameters. You need to be between 21 and 45 years of ages, with a stable prescription for at the very least a year.


If you have modest to severe myopia or hyperopia, and your corneas are also thin for LASIK, EVO ICL might be a wonderful option for you. In addition, if you experience completely dry eyes or other corneal problems, this treatment can supply you with the vision adjustment you require without aggravating those problems.

It's also essential that you remain in excellent general health and wellness and have practical expectations regarding the outcomes. Consulting with an eye treatment professional will certainly assist determine if you're an ideal candidate for the procedure.
